How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Maymont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Maymont Park Studio Apartments | $1,504 | $928 | $2,374 |
Maymont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,608 | $856 | $3,225 |
| Maymont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,861 | $1,020 | $4,265 |
| Maymont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,000 | $946 | $4,562 |
| Maymont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,183 | $710 | $3,300 |
